The Established Standards of Casino Withdrawal Speeds
Across the online gaming industry, payout speed varies widely based on payment methods and banking infrastructure. Most major operators process withdrawal requests quickly on their end, but the actual transfer of funds often depends on third-party financial networks. These networks introduce delays that players have historically accepted as unavoidable.
DraftKings provides a clear example of this range. The fastest possible option is in-person cash cage pickup, which can take around one hour. However, this method is limited by geography and availability. Digital withdrawals typically take longer with debit card or real-time banking withdrawals averaging around 24 hours, and PayPal withdrawals usually complete within 48 hours. Slower methods, such as ACH bank transfers,can take two to five business days, while checks sent by mail may require seven to ten business days.
FanDuel operates in a similar timeframe. Some fast payout methods can process within a couple of hours, yet more traditional routes such as debit cards and online banking can still take up to five business days. The contrast between fast fintech rails and slower banking infrastructure highlights a key industry reality. Speed often depends less on the casino and more on the financial system behind it. These timelines illustrate a broader truth. Even at the most advanced traditional platforms, waiting remains part of the experience.

Why Withdrawal Speed Remains a Complex Metric
To understand why instant payouts are so significant, one must look at the factors that traditionally slow withdrawals. The payment method is the largest variable. Crypto and e-wallets tend to be the fastest, while bank transfers and debit cards can take several days. Debit cards typically require one to three days, and bank transfers often take one to five business days.
Verification is another major factor. Identity checks can add hours or even days, particularly for first-time withdrawals. Many players experience their longest delays during their first payout because verification must be completed before funds can be released. This step is necessary for security, but adds to the total wait time.
